In an electronic file system, preview information is provided to the user during a drag operation of a selected object onto a target object. The information indicates what type(s) of action is to be taken should the selected object be dropped onto the target object. The action(s) to be taken may depend upon the type of the selected object and/or the type of the target object. For example, where the selected object is an item and the target object is a persisted auto-list, the action may include adding, removing, or modifying one or more properties of the selected object to conform to one or more criteria defined by the persisted auto-list. Also, numerical feedback may be provided to the user where multiple objects are selected. For example, where seven objects are selected, the textual number “7” may appear next to the cursor.

What is claimed is: 1. A computer-readable storage medium storing computer-executable instructions for performing steps comprising: (a) receiving first user input to a graphical user interface; (b) detecting that the first user input represents a dragging of a first object to a second object; (c) in response to step (b), displaying a plurality of icons simultaneously, each of the plurality of icons representing a different type of a plurality of actions that will be taken in response to a dropping of the first object onto the second object, wherein said displaying is presented to a user in response to said first object being moved proximate to said second object; and (d) responsive to the first object being dropped onto the second object after the step of displaying, causing the plurality of actions to be performed, wherein the plurality of icons displayed is determined based upon a type of the first object and a type of the second object. 2. The computer-readable storage medium of claim 1, wherein the computer-executable instructions are further for: (e) detecting that a third user input represents a selecting of the first object together with at least a third object; and in response to step (e), displaying a textual number representing a quantity of the objects that are selected. 3. The computer-readable storage medium of claim 2, wherein the textual number is displayed such that the textual number moves with movement of a cursor. 4. The computer-readable storage medium of claim 1, wherein the plurality of icons simultaneously displayed moves with movement of a cursor. 5. The computer-readable storage medium of claim 1, wherein the plurality of icons simultaneously displayed does not move with movement of a cursor. 6. The computer-readable storage medium of claim 1, wherein the plurality of icons are each a different graphical icon depending upon what the plurality of actions comprises. 7. The computer-readable storage medium of claim 1, wherein one of the plurality of actions is a moving of a file system location of the first object. 8. The computer-readable storage medium of claim 1, wherein one of the plurality of actions is a copying of the first object. 9. The computer-readable storage medium of claim 1, wherein one of the plurality of actions is an adding of a reference to the first object in the second object. 10. The computer-readable storage medium of claim 1, wherein one of the plurality of actions is a modifying, adding, or removing of at least one property of the first object to meet at least one criterion defined by the second object. 11. The computer-readable storage medium of claim 1, wherein the displaying includes a textual description of the plurality of actions. 12. The computer-readable storage medium of claim 1, wherein the displaying is not presented until the first object is dragged to the second object. 13. A computer-implemented method of dragging and dropping an object, the computer-implemented method comprising: (a) receiving first user input to a graphical user interface; (b) detecting that the first user input represents a dragging of a first object to a second object; (c) in response to step (b), displaying a plurality of icons simultaneously, each of the plurality of icons representing a different type of a plurality of actions that will be taken in response to a dropping of the first object onto the second object, wherein said displaying is presented to a user in response to said first object being moved proximate to said second object; and (d) responsive to the first object being dropped onto the second object after the step of displaying, causing the plurality of actions to be performed, wherein the plurality of icons displayed is determined based upon a type of the first object and a type of the second object. 14. The computer-implemented method of claim 13, wherein one of the plurality of actions comprises a moving of a file system location of the first object. 15. The computer-implemented method of claim 13, wherein one of the plurality of actions comprises a copying of the first object. 16. The computer-implemented method of claim 13, wherein one of the plurality of actions comprises a modifying, adding, or removing of at least one property of the first object to meet at least one criterion defined by the second object. 17. A drag and drop computer-implemented system having a computer processor, memory, and data storage subsystems, the memory having stored thereon computer-executable instructions for execution by the processor, the drag and drop computer-implemented system, comprising: a first user input received into a graphical user interface of the drag and drop computer-implemented system, wherein the first user input comprises a first object moved proximate to a second object; a plurality of icons simultaneously displayed, wherein each of the plurality of icons represents a different type of a plurality of actions that will be taken in response to the first object being dropped onto the second object, and the plurality of icons displayed is determined based upon a type of the first object and a type of the second object; a second user input received into the graphical user interface of the drag and drop computer-implemented system, wherein the second user input comprises the first object dropped onto the second object; and a plurality of completed tasks in response to the first object dropped onto the second object, wherein the plurality of icons simultaneously displayed are indicative of the plurality of completed tasks. 18. The drag and drop computer-implemented system of claim 17, wherein one of the plurality of actions comprises a moved file system location of the first object. 19. The drag and drop computer-implemented system of claim 17, wherein one of the plurality of actions comprises a copy of the first object. 20. The drag and drop computer-implemented system of claim 17, wherein one of the plurality of actions comprises a modification, addition, or removal of at least one property of the first object in order to meet at least one criterion defined by the second object.
